Transaction 84bb323525ffee97d388d10ba96d20c0eaf0ae014a8ed4a972e00b9431a51c2a

block
e31ae8ab00707c0a85f9d679e86934eefa223c6e7a19bdb428b39c5aafa9a50d

1 Input

2 Outputs